
These are my current top 3 favorite tips that save money and I wish I'd already known. So I'm sharing. Cheers! I'm convinced there's somewhat of a conspiracy that folks don't all know this, because there's no money in it!
1) The sun gets out all organic stains, screw stain stick.
2) Vinegar cleans cloth diapers, and gets them smelling brand new. Nothing fancier.
3) Neti pots, it's so weird to pour water in one nostril and out another that I was afraid to try it, but presto, you can breathe before bed, and you can prevent sinus infections. And no antibiotics. I'm SO sold.
Bonus parenting tip.
4) If your kid puts a bead up her nose, pinch the good side and blow into her mouth CPR style. Out comes the round object. Skip the Minor Injury Clinic or ER.
